Title: Basis of Presentation Accounting Policies: Expenditures reported on the Schedule are reported on the accrual basis of accounting. Expenses are recognized as incurred using the cost accounting principles contained in the Uniform Guidance. Under those cost principles, certain types of expenses are not allowable or are limited as to reimbursement. Expenditures include costs that can be directly identified to a program plus allocations of applicable indirect costs. The indirect costs applied are negotiated percentages of direct expenses. Indirect cost rates applied to awards for the year ended June 30, 2023 were negotiated with the cognizant federal rate agency, the Department of Health and Human Services. De Minimis Rate Used: N Rate Explanation: The auditee did not use the de minimus rate. The accompanying schedule of expenditures of federal awards (the Schedule) includes the federal grant activity of College of the Atlantic (the College) under programs of the federal government for the year ended June 30, 2023. The information in this Schedule is presented in accordance with the requirements of Title 2 U.S. Code of Federal Regulations Part 200, Uniform Administrative Requirements, Cost Principles, and Audit Requirements for Federal Awards (Uniform Guidance). Therefore, some amounts presented in this schedule may differ from amounts presented in, or used in the preparation of, the basic financial statements. Because the Schedule presents only a selected portion of the operations of College of the Atlantic, it is not intended to and does not present the financial position, changes in net assets, or cash flows of College of the Atlantic.
